Logging services provided by DW Mulching and Excavating, LLC in Fairfield, IL focus on clearing trees, handling wood materials, and preparing land for different site needs. The process usually starts with checking the area to understand what trees or growth need to be removed. After that, the team plans how to safely cut and move the wood without causing damage to the ground or nearby spaces.
Trees are then cut in a controlled way and sorted based on size and condition. Some wood may be removed from the site, while other parts may be stacked or prepared for transport. Equipment is used to help with lifting and moving heavy logs so the work stays steady and safe. The land is then cleaned to make it ready for the next step of use. This service helps manage overgrown areas and supports better land use in Fairfield, IL.
